Foldable Revolution: The iPhone Fold and Apple’s New Era of Flexible Smartphones in 2026

The arrival of the iPhone Fold undoubtedly constitutes the most visible transformation in the Apple lineup. Designed to respond to the rise of foldable smartphones, this model will be launched in 2026 in a “clamshell” format, reminiscent of the Galaxy Z Flip design, but with such a refined technical signature that it should revolutionize user experience. The usual issue with this type of product — the appearance of a crease on the screen — would here be completely eliminated by advanced and unprecedented in-house engineering.

Apple thus intends to offer a perfectly smooth and continuous display once the smartphone is opened, ensuring visual immersion without compromise. This challenge required the development of a new screen material and revisited internal mechanisms to ensure durability and flexibility without sacrificing the thinness of the device. This model thus promises to be Apple’s technological comeback in a segment it had so far approached cautiously.

iPhone 20 in 2027: The Pinnacle of “All-Screen” Design to Celebrate Two Decades of Success

In 2027, Apple will celebrate a milestone anniversary and intends to make a strong impact with an iPhone 20 designed as a true technological and aesthetic masterpiece. This ultra-premium model embodies Steve Jobs’ original vision of a smartphone whose screen constitutes the entirety of the front face, with no obstruction whatsoever. To achieve this, Apple has adopted advanced under-display camera (UDC) technology, making the device completely transparent and offering an unprecedented immersive visual experience.

The overall design of this smartphone should make a sensation thanks to its curved glass finish on all four edges, a craftsmanship feat that literally melts the iPhone in the hand. The ergonomics will also be rethought to do away with physical buttons: the edges will be touch-sensitive, offering haptic zones that replace traditional controls. This disappearance of buttons will bring a new refined dimension to phone handling.

Unrivaled Power Driven by 2nm Etching

On the components side, the iPhone 20 will be equipped with the first 2-nanometer etched chips thanks to the partnership with TSMC. This extreme miniaturization will optimize performance while reducing energy consumption, a crucial element for thermal management and battery life. The impact on local artificial intelligence capabilities will translate into ever more advanced and faster intelligent functions, enhancing the iPhone’s responsiveness to your daily interactions.

This will open new perspectives, notably in computational photography, augmented reality, and voice processing. These are features that today’s users can only scratch the surface of, but which will become the standard with this generation.

iPhone 21 in 2028: An Extensive Range Integrating Advanced Artificial Intelligence

The year 2028 will be marked by the stabilization of a broadened and extremely diversified iPhone range. Up to seven distinct models will cater to very varied user profiles. Apple has thus planned to cover all economic segments and expectations by integrating artificial intelligence as a common thread of this offer.

The Four Main Families of iPhone

The segmentation is designed to specifically respond to the needs and ambitions of consumers:

  • “e” Series: aimed at an audience seeking an affordable iPhone, succeeding the SE models, suited for simple daily use without cutting essential features.
  • Air Series: focuses on thinness and style, with lightweight, elegant models that emphasize aesthetics while ensuring good performance.
  • Pro and Pro Max Series: these models are dedicated to professionals and experts, highlighting raw power, advanced photo sensors notably periscopic for exceptional zooms.
  • Fold Series: the premium foldable segment, with a premium positioning for technology and innovation enthusiasts.

Integrated Artificial Intelligence, a True Personal Agent

iOS 28, which will accompany these new devices, introduces a new era of Apple Intelligence. This AI becomes proactive, anticipating your digital needs to efficiently manage your appointments, reminders, communications, and much more, without constant user intervention. Siri 2.0 thus transforms into an autonomous personal agent, capable of adapting to your life habits and offering personalized recommendations in real time.

For example, this AI can analyze your calendars and trips to automatically suggest the best route depending on traffic conditions, or anticipate your battery recharge needs according to your daily usage.

The Evolution of Mobile Photography: Periscopic Zoom and Under-Display Sensors

Photography remains a major focus for Apple in its future models. The iPhone 21 Pro and Pro Max lineup embodies this desire to push photography quality limits, notably with the introduction of advanced periscopic zooms, capable of offering highly detailed shots at long distances without sacrificing smartphone compactness.

This technology relies on an innovative optical system, using mirrors and lenses arranged like a periscope, allowing magnifications never before seen in Apple devices. The results are striking, delivering sharp and bright images previously reserved for professional cameras.

At the same time, the Face ID sensors under the screen, which will appear in 2026 on Pro models, improve not only aesthetics but also user privacy. By integrating these elements beneath the panel, Apple ensures fast, secure, and discreet facial recognition without any visual intrusion.
